f667ae7ceab16384ee4e9ea4d6144d37650509067e4d37e6d81f3bd11977d8e3

1375951 (443960 blocks ago)

⏴ Block 1375950 (5f4583bb…ddd) | Block 1375952 ⏵ | Latest block ⏭

Metadata

29/07/2023, 17:04 UTC (616d 14:41:52 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details